Rally Catalunya 2001 counts for:
2001 FIA World Rally Championship for Drivers/Co-drivers 2001 FIA World Rally Championship for Manufacturers 2001 FIA Cup for Drivers of Production Cars 2001 FIA Cup for Drivers of Super 1600 Cars
|
| 337th WRC rally |
| Round of season: | 4 of 14 |
| Official name: | Rallye Catalunya Costa Brava - Rallye de Espana |
| Edition: | 37th |
| Date: | from Thursday 22-Mar-2001 to Sunday 25-Mar-2001 |
| Surface: | Tarmac |
| |
| Entries: | 79 | |
| Starters: | 76 | |
| Finishers: | 36 | (47.4% of starters) |
| |
| Stages: | 18 | |
| Shortest: | 12.90 | km | (SS1 La Trona 1) |
| Longest: | 35.89 | km | (SS12 La Riba 2) |
| Slowest: | 80.60 | km/h | (SS11 Escaladei 2) |
| Fastest: | 101.70 | km/h | (SS6 Vallfogona 2) |
| Planned stage distance: | 383.18 | km | (21.5% of total distance) |
| Actual stage distance: | 347.29 | km | (19.5% of total distance) |
| Road section distance: | 1,431.84 | km |
| Total distance: | 1,779.13 | km |
|
| DRIVERS - PODIUM FINISHERS |
| | Win was 20th win and 50th podium for Didier Auriol. |
| Second place was 6th podium for Gilles Panizzi. |
| Third place was 39th podium for Tommi Makinen. |
| MAKES - PODIUM FINISHERS |
| | Win was 29th win and 1-2 win were 59th to 60th podiums for Peugeot. |
| | Third place was 72nd podium for Mitsubishi. |
